In sintesi

You might encounter either wet or dry avalanche problems based on the amount of new snow you find and how warm it gets. Keep an eye on evolving conditions throughout the day. Test the bond of new snow layers before heading into steeper terrain. Limit your exposure to steep slopes where you witness fresh rollerballs or other signs of instability.

    You could find anywhere between a few inches to foot of new snow depending on elevation and location in the forecast zone. This snow is falling on a cooling trend and winds are forecast to decrease, so it should be right-side-up. On the other hand, new slabs could have a poor bond to the crust below, or become more reactive with warming.

    If you find more than about 6” of new snow, slab avalanches could be an issue. As usual, there will be more new snow in wind loaded terrain. Cornices and other clues should point toward the slopes holding the most new snow. Track new snow depth as you gain elevation or change aspects. This should be easy to do with a crust below the new snow. Simple tests can help you gauge stability.

    The new snow could also produce loose snow avalanches when warmed by temperature, direct sun, or greenhousing. Avoid travel on or directly below steep slopes where you see fresh rollerballs or small avalanches. The biggest risk might be in upper elevation areas where there is the most new snow. Low elevation areas should pick up minimal new snow and are less likely to have this problem.

    Don’t linger directly under cornices, snowy cliffs, or glide cracks lurking in the terrain above you. The likelihood of seeing additional wet avalanche activity or cornice falls is quite low, but it’s not totally out of the question.

    Look out for wet avalanches that start in steep and rocky terrain, especially if the sun comes out or you experience greenhouse conditions.

Avalanche Discussion

Friday was another quiet one, with only a handful of observations submitted from around the Cascades. In general, wet snow avalanche problems from the past week are diminishing as temperatures cool and there is less free running water to weaken the snowpack.

West North saw the most new snow with about 4” of moist new snow reported from 5000’. The new snow was observed to have a poor bond to the old snow surface, and small wet loose avalanches were easy to trigger. Similar new snow instabilities were found in Snoqualmie Pass.  A skiff of new snow was reported to improve riding conditions in Stevens Pass.  No new avalanches were reported from that forecast zone.
